Birdline ACT

Published sightings for the week ending 23 Sep 2012.

Sun 23 Sep Black-winged Stilt Kellys Swamp & Jerrabomberra Wetlands, Fyshwick
Black-winged Stilt (2) seen at Shoveler's Pond in the paddocks adjacent to the wetlands
Brendan Sheean

White-browed Woodswallow Macgregor
White-browed Woodswallow A flock of about 20 woodswallows flew over my house this morning at about 8.15. There were no Maskeds amongst the flock
Scott Ryan

Peaceful Dove Bibaringa, Cotter Road, Stromlo
Peaceful Dove (2) seen, 1 calling in a tree and the other feeding in a paddock.
Brendan Sheean

Thu 20 Sep Dusky Woodswallow Shepherds Lookout
A pair of Dusky Woodswallows flying around the lookout reserve
Roger Wiliiams

Tue 18 Sep White-bellied Sea-eagle Molonglo River adjacent to Gladstone St, Fyshwick
White-bellied Sea-eagle observed flying east along molonglo river whilst being harrassed by ravens at 14:00 today.
Darcy Ginty

Mon 17 Sep Eastern Barn Owl On the roof of 199 Mabo Blvd Bonner ACT
At 4.45pm, Kye and I spotted what we believe was a Eastern Barn Owl on the roof. After a bit of research the owl we saw had a distinctive white face with brown body. It was being harassed by 7 ravens, I clapped my hands to shoo the ravens away but the owl flew off as well - that ruined my chances of a photo. Kye followed the owl to a large tree in Forde, the neighboring suburb. [Moderator's comment: Whilst the bird was not conclusively identified by the observers, it seems on the balance of probabilities to have been a Barn Owl]
Kye and Karen Moggridge

Sun 16 Sep Rose Robin Point Hut
A COG group saw a male Rose Robin at the Point Hut picnic area.
Sandra Henderson + many others

Sat 15 Sep Rufous Songlark Mulligan's Flat Sanctuary
A furtive male Rufous Songlark was observed in the heart of Mulligan's Flat Sanctuary in long grass. Presumably a returning migrant, this species is rarely seen at Mulligan's Flat.
PJ Milburn
